Event contracts let you express your view on whether the price of key futures markets will move up or down by the end of each day's trading session. You can select from the following CME event contracts, and to trade, just choose YES or NO.You can buy event contracts at any price between 1¢ and 99¢. At close, each contract is worth $1 if you're right, and $0 otherwise. You can sell early if you want to. Contract Title/Rulebook Chapter/Commodity Code Underlying Futures Contract/Rulebook Chapter/Commodity Code CME Equity Event Contract ...Dec 2, 2023 · Profitable trade example. Based on current market conditions, an individual believes the price of gold will increase. They see the current price of gold at $2,001, with an event contract based on whether the price of Gold futures will settle above $2,000 at 12:30 p.m. CT. Event Contracts allow investors to trade the outcome of certain futures markets using short-term, limited risk contracts offered by CME Group, including underlying equity index, currency, energy and metals contracts. Interactive Brokers enables trading of such Event Contracts using its EventTrader platform. In the event of market manipulation, lack of liquidity, or fluctuations in ...
